How Forgiving Others Helps You to Restore Your Own Humanity

https://www.psychologytoday.com/us/blog/the-forgiving-life/202210/how-forgiving-others-helps-you-to-restore-your-own-humanity

Gratitude and forgiveness. Perhaps the two bookends of a well-shaped mind. And both are practices, not automatically given at birth. My favorite article this year was no doubt the research into Abraham Maslow’s hierarchy of needs with the highest need being revealed as self-transcendence rather than self-actualization. Forgiveness and gratitude are key components of self-transcendence.
